TH 60 – 4th Street NW Weekly Construction Updates – Week 10
The City of Faribault and its project partners intend to send out and publish a weekly construction update on the TH 60/4th Street NW Reconstruction Project. Previous Week Review 6/8/19 to 6/14/19
Curb and gutter was installed from 1st Ave NW through the 2nd Ave NW intersection and more sidewalk was installed between Central Avenue and 2nd Avenue. These first two blocks are getting shaped up in anticipation of paving as early as next week. The existing pavement was removed between 3rd Ave NW and 4th Ave NW and the mainline sanitary sewer was installed in this block as well.
Next Week Look Ahead 6/15/2019 to 6/21/2019
The contractor will continue to subcut the road place drain tile, sand, gravel, concrete curb and gutter, sidewalk and signal work to 3rd Avenue N.W. Watermain and storm sewer utilities are scheduled to be completed between 3rd Ave NW and 4th Ave NW. Subcontractors are scheduled to continue installing street light foundations and poles as well as some more of the underground components for the traffic signal systems at Central Avenue and 2nd Avenue.
The first two of three lifts of bituminous pavement are schedule to be placed towards the end of next week from Central Avenue through the 2nd Avenue intersection. The contractor may also mill off the existing bituminous surface of the road from 4th Avenue NW up to 6th Avenue NW on Friday June 21st. Following mill operations the road would be reopened for the weekend on the underlying concrete surface.
General Traffic Control/Detour Notes
During the duration of the entire project and through the entire project limits which extend from Lyndale Avenue/TH 21 on the west end to Central Avenue on the east end, thru traffic will be detoured off TH 60 and rerouted along 2nd Avenue NW, TH 3/20th Street NW and TH 21 (see detour map link above) Portions of TH 60/4th Street NW within the project limits may be signed “Road Open to Local Traffic or Road Closed to Thru Traffic” or something similar. Please keep in mind that “local traffic/access” is defined as having direct access on TH 60, or having business with someone or a business who has direct access on TH 60. If you do not fall into either of these two categories, you should not be on TH 60 within the project limits at any time. Travel on TH 60 within the project limits should take place only when there is no other possible alternative. Also please be respectful of private property and do not use private property to “short cut” the detour route.
Pedestrian traffic will be maintained to the maximum extent practical to provide access to businesses and residents who have access to TH 60, however other portions of sidewalk will be closed to facilitate construction work and those sidewalks will be detoured along an alternate pedestrian route (typically around the block). Phase 1 Access Notes:
Phase 1 is under construction from Central Avenue to 3rd Avenue NW. At this time all intersections from Central Avenue to 3rd Avenue are closed for local access unless noted otherwise below. The alleyways between Central Avenue and 2nd Avenue are closed as well. No unauthorized traffic is to enter the TH 60 roadway at these closed intersections. The intersection of 2nd Avenue is currently open and will be closed again on/or around June 20th to complete paving operations in Phase 1.
The intersection of TH 60 (4th St NW) and Central Avenue is currently closed to allow for traffic signal work to be completed. A reminder that when the intersection is closed, the three or four parking stalls on each side of Central Avenue closest to 4th Street will be marked no parking and a U-Turn area set up to allow traffic to continue to utilize parking on both sides of Central Avenue (see page 3 of attached map for more details).
Traffic is permitted on 1st Ave and 2nd Ave on both sides of TH 60 up to the construction project limits. On-street parking on the avenues is also open. Phase 2 Access Notes:
Currently 4th St NW/TH 60 is closed between 3rd Avenue and 4th Avenue NW for Phase 2 construction. 3rd Avenue NW is open to two way traffic up to the Fareway Foods driveway entrance. During initial Phase 2 construction, either the intersection of TH 60 & 2nd Ave NW or the intersection of TH 60 & 4th Ave NW will be open to north/south traffic to provide a crossing of TH 60. Please pay attention to traffic control signage as this may change intermittently depending on construction operations.
The Contractor has also indicated that they will be progressing further into Phase 2 (4th Avenue NW to 6th Avenue NW) starting the week of June 24th. See note above under the Next Week Look Ahead about the possibility of bituminous milling between 4th Ave NW and 6th Ave NW on Friday June 21st. Project representatives will be meeting with property owners early next week to discuss access requirements and schedules of operations.
